Hi Nancy: Both of these medications have similar side effects. Since we all react differently with medications it's impossible to know what, if any, side effects we'll experience. Here's a link to both of the drugs side effects and you can read what it says. They both say common side effects are: stomache ache, pain in back/joint, and flu-like symptoms. Boniva mentions diarrhea also. If you should develop trouble swallowing with either drug discontinue and contact your Dr. There is a listing of less common side effects on both of these medications that you can read at the links below.
